The Miami Dolphins are a professional American football team based in the Miami metropolitan area. They compete in the National Football League (NFL) as a member club of the league's American Football Conference (AFC) East division. Founded by Joe Robbie and Danny Thomas in 1965, with their inaugural season in 1966, the Dolphins are the oldest professional sports team in Florida. They are renowned for their historic 1972 undefeated season, the only NFL team to achieve this feat, culminating in a Super Bowl VII victory. The team plays its home games at Hard Rock Stadium and conducts football operations at the adjacent Baptist Health Training Complex in Miami Gardens.

The Miami Dolphins cultivate a significant global fan base through various engagement strategies. This includes participation in NFL International Series games (e.g., in London and Germany), targeted digital media and content for international audiences, and global merchandise distribution. The team holds international marketing rights in countries like Brazil, the United Kingdom, and Spain, actively working to grow the Dolphins brand and American football fandom worldwide.

Hard Rock Stadium, the home of the Miami Dolphins, was officially announced as the venue for the final match of the CONMEBOL Copa América 2024™ tournament, scheduled for July 14, 2024. This highlights the stadium's status as a premier global sports and entertainment destination....more

The Miami Dolphins confirmed they have signed General Manager Chris Grier to a multi-year contract extension. This move ensures stability in their football operations leadership as the team aims to build on recent playoff appearances and continue its competitive development....more
